As another member pointed out, I would also want to keep the precats and with that said, I would prefer if the triangular/cat mounting flanges have the proper machined groove for the crush gasket. FITMENT would be paramount to HP in my opinion, of course they will perform better over stock but there is nothing more annoying then dealing with improper fitment during an header installation. When flange angles aren't precise and gaskets don't line up perfectly etc., this usually leads to the most annoying exhaust leak noise. Oh, and 1/2" thickness's for the precat and head flange's would be great.
